Position Summary

The Sr. Director, Non-Utility and Accounting Strategy is responsible for leading the Company's non-utility accounting function and providing strategic direction over technical accounting, benefits accounting and accounting for new business growth.

This role drives consistency in accounting policy application, and serves as a key advisor to senior leadership on complex accounting matters, new transactions, and strategic initiatives.

Tasks and Responsibilities

Leadership and Organizational Oversight
  • Lead and develop the Technical & Benefits Accounting and Non-Utility Accounting teams, ensuring clear priorities, strong performance management, and ongoing capability development.
  • Establish clear accountability across teams for quality and accuracy, compliance, analysis and strategic thinking, and process execution.
  • Foster a high-performing, collaborative environment and build strong cross-functional relationships across Finance and the broader business.

Technical Accounting and Policy Leadership
  • Oversee accounting research and evaluation of complex transactions, contracts, and new business activities, ensuring appropriate accounting treatment and documentation.
  • Serve as the Company's senior accounting subject matter expert across key areas including consolidation, leasing, revenue recognition, investments, derivatives, impairments, and the accounting for rate-regulated entities.
  • Monitor and assess new accounting standards for utilities specific issues, coordinate with implementation efforts, and ensure alignment across the organization.
  • Oversee development and maintenance of business unit specific accounting policies and procedures, ensuring consistency with corporate standards and regulatory requirements.

Benefits Accounting Oversight
  • Provide strategic oversight of accounting and reporting for all employee and retiree benefit plans, including pensions, health and welfare plans, and defined contribution plans.
  • Ensure appropriate accounting treatment, audit readiness, and financial reporting compliance for all benefit-related activities.
  • Advise leadership on financial and accounting implications of benefit plan strategies and cost assumptions.

Non-Utility Accounting and Reporting
  • Oversee the monthly close process and production of financial statements for non-utility operations, ensuring accuracy, timeliness, and compliance with GAAP and regulatory requirements as required.
  • Ensure strong coordination with internal and external auditors and oversee audit deliverables and timelines.
  • Partner with senior leadership to support financial statement reviews, filings, and reporting requirements.
  • Provide strategic support and financial oversight for non-utility business leaders.

Strategy, Change, and Continuous Improvement
  • Lead accounting strategy across non-utility and technical areas, ensuring alignment with business priorities and regulatory expectations.
  • Oversee finance change control processes to identify and assess impacts of business changes on financial reporting.
  • Drive continuous improvement in non-utility accounting processes, systems, and controls, including identifying opportunities to enhance efficiency and effectiveness.
  • Lead cross-functional initiatives to improve finance processes and support business growth and transformation.

About AltaGas Ltd.

AltaGas Ltd. is a Canadian energy infrastructure company that operates in three segments: Gas, Power, and Utilities. The company was founded in 1994 and is headquartered in Calgary, Alberta. AltaGas owns and operates natural gas processing plants, pipelines, and storage facilities in Canada and the United States. The company also generates and sells electricity and provides energy services to customers in Canada. In 2019, AltaGas generated CAD 6.2 billion in revenue.
